So... I finally got my skates fitted!!!! WOHOO!!!! I decided to explore all the options and this is what I decided to get.

~ Boots ~

Custom Klingbeil boots... Fitted to my own feet... Strong enough for triples!

~ Blades ~

Pattern 99 Parabolic Blades with a K-pick.

Parabolic - Thinner in the middle and fatter at the ends for nicer edges, more centered spins, and nicer take offs on jumps.

K - Pick - For more stable toe jumps, higher and longer jumps.

I kind of agonized over the parabolic blades for a little bit because of the fact that I didn't get real good reviews for them. I analyzed the way they work and it made a lot of sense to me. For the amount of edge work I do, it kinda makes sense to try them. I went ahead with it. We will see how it works!! I am VERY EXCITED!!
